Deuteronomy 27:18

Cursed be he that makes the blind to wander out of the way. And all the people shall say, Amen.
Read Chapter 27

George Leo Haydock

AD 1849
Blind; or, according to the Rabbins and Grotius, those who are on a journey, and do not know the road. "Cursed, said Diphilis, is the man who does not tell the right road. "Those who lead the simple astray, are no less blameable, Leviticus xix. 14. (Calmet)

Irenaeus of Lyons

AD 202
This [that is, the behavior of the Gnostics] is not the behavior of those who heal and give life but rather of those who aggravate disease and increase ignorance. The law shows itself much truer than such people when it says that whoever leads a blind man astray from the way is accursed. The apostles were sent to find those who were lost and to bring sight to those who did not see and healing to the sick. They did not speak to them in accordance with their previous opinions but by a revelation of the truth. For no one would be acting rightly if one told the blind who were already beginning to fall over the precipice to continue in their dangerous way as if it were a sound one and as if they would come through all right. .
